Ever wondered how a baseball team could intertwine itself into the fabric of a community and lift it up?
The Memphis Red Sox did just that from 1920 to 1959.
Discover the remarkable legacy of the Memphis Red Sox, one of the most influential Negro League teams, with our guest Dr. Keith B. Wood.
In this episode, you'll learn how the Red Sox created a cultural phenomenon that transcended sports during the Jim Crow era. Dr. Wood reveals untold stories and fascinating insights from his latest book, "The Memphis Red Sox: A Negro League's History," shedding light on the team's unique impact compared to more famous counterparts like the Kansas City Monarchs and Pittsburgh Crawfords.

Dr. Wood also shares his personal journey from educator and coach to historian, emphasizing the importance of authenticity and compassion in teaching. His reflections on different educational environments and coaching roles illustrate universal lessons about caring for students from all walks of life.
